In Rugby League news, Phil “Gus” Gould has left his job at the Penrith Panthers. He says it was simply time.
Tom Robson reports.
TRANSCRIPT
There were tears from players and staff as Gould left the place he’s called home for many years.
First as a player, then coach and finally, a boss.
Some say he jumped, others, that he was pushed.
The board met today to decide the exit strategy.
Penrith’s chairman denies there were any dramas.
David O’Neill, Penrith Chairman:”I’ve had a great relationship with Phil. And, and, and they’re grown men him and Ivan. They get on, they know their job and so forth.”
Commentators say Gould won’t be out of work long.
Both The Cronulla Sharks and the Dragons are already showing interest.
In AFL, the Melbourne Demons have swung the axe ahead of the Anzac Eve clash.
They’ve made made five changes to their lineup.
While the Richmond Tigers have just one change, Jack Riewoldt returns from a wrist injury.
More than 70,000 fans will pack out the MCG.
